Run with the -testnet option to run with "play dogecoins" on the test network, if you are testing multi-machine code that needs to operate across the internet. The Qt code routes qDebug() output to debug.log under category "qt": run with -debug=qt to see it. command-line option controls debugging running with just -debug will turn on all categories (and give you a very large debug.log file). If the code is behaving strangely, take a look in the debug.log file in the data directory error and debugging messages are written there. Or run configure with CXXFLAGS="-g -ggdb -O0" or whatever debug flags you need. Run configure with the -enable-debug option, then make. Originally, a different payout scheme was envisioned with block rewards being determined by taking the maximum reward as per the block schedule and applying the result of a Mersenne Twister pseudo-random number generator to arrive at a number between 0 and the maximum reward. Starting with the 600,000th block, a permanent reward of 10,000 Dogecoin per block will be issued. The block rewards are fixed and halve every 100,000 blocks. Such mining informationĭogecoin uses a simplified variant of the scrypt key derivation function as its proof of work with a target time of one minute per block and difficulty readjustment after every block. Each subsequent block will grant 10,000 coins to encourage miners to continue to secure the network and make up for lost wallets on hard drives/phones/lost encryption passwords/etc. How much doge can exist? – So many puppies!Įarly 2015 (approximately a year and a half after release) there will be approximately 100,000,000,000 coins. It is useful to add a test plan to the pull request description if testing the changes is not straightforward. This is especially important for large or high-risk changes. These tests can be run (if the test dependencies are installed) with: qa/pull-tester/rpc-tests.pyĬhanges should be tested by somebody other than the developer who wrote the code. There are also regression and integration tests of the RPC interface, written in Python, that are run automatically on the build server. Further details on running and extending unit tests can be found in /src/test/README.md. Unit tests can be compiled and run (assuming they weren't disabled in configure) with: make check. Contributionsĭevelopers are strongly encouraged to write unit tests for new code, and to submit new unit tests for old code. Maintenance branches are there for bug fixes only, please submit new features against the development branch with the highest version. Planned releases will always have a development branch and pull requests should be submitted against those. Master and maintenance branches are exclusively mutable by release. development: Unstable, contains new code for planned releases.maintenance: Stable, contains the latest version of previous releases, which are still under active maintenance.master: Stable, contains the latest version of the latest major.minor release.There are 3 types of branches in this repository: Version numbers are following semantics. Taking development cues from Tenebrix and Litecoin, Dogecoin currently employs a simplified variant of scrypt.ĭogecoin Core is released under the terms of the MIT license. Dogecoin is a cryptocurrency like Bitcoin, although it does not use SHA256 as its proof of work (POW).
